Lagoon Motel

5915 N Lagoon Dr, Panama City 32408, Florida United States

5915 N Lagoon Dr Panama City, Florida 32408 United States

Ratings & Review

Uh oh! We couldn't find any review for this listing.
Post Review

Popular Listings

Related Listings